Updated Super Bowl odds peg Patriots, Panthers as co-favorites

Jim Dedmon-USA TODAY Sports / Reuters

The New England Patriots and Carolina Panthers are co-favorites to win Super Bowl 50, according to updated betting odds released by the Westgate Las Vegas SuperBook this week.

Despite losing two straight games for the first time since 2012, the Patriots are tied with the Panthers at 4-1 odds to hoist the Lombardi Trophy in February.

The Arizona Cardinals, winners of six straight, remain among the favorites at 9-2, while the Pittsburgh Steelers jump from 30-1 to 12-1.
